Job description

SHEQ Manager


Our client, a growing specialist in transmission and renewable energy infrastructure, is seeking a SHEQ Manager to support the safe and effective delivery of grid-scale battery energy storage, solar and wind projects in Glasgow. This permanent role will focus on health and safety management, environmental compliance and quality assurance across complex construction and energy projects.

Key Responsibilities:
  • Implement, maintain and monitor SHEQ policies, procedures and management systems across renewable energy projects
  • Conduct risk assessments, site inspections and compliance reviews in line with relevant health and safety legislation
  • Provide SHEQ training, inductions and toolbox talks to employees and subcontractors
  • Support accident and incident investigations, identifying root causes and implementing corrective actions
  • Ensure compliance with ISO 45001, ISO 14001 and ISO 9001 standards
  • Monitor environmental and sustainability initiatives across BESS, solar and wind projects
  • Prepare SHEQ reports and maintain accurate records, documentation and performance data
  • Work closely with project teams to promote a strong safety culture and integrate SHEQ requirements into project planning and delivery
Job Requirements:
  • Experience in a SHEQ, health and safety or quality management role within renewable energy, BESS or construction
  • In-depth knowledge of health, safety, environmental and quality regulations
  • Strong understanding of risk assessment methodologies and accident investigation techniques
  • Experience working with ISO 45001, ISO 14001 and ISO 9001 management systems
  • Excellent communication, training and influencing skills
  • Proficiency in report writing, data analysis and quality documentation
  • Strong attention to detail, organisation and problem-solving abilities
  • NEBOSH General Certificate or equivalent qualification is desirable, with NEBOSH Diploma-level knowledge advantageous
Desirable Qualifications:
  • IEMA environmental qualification
  • Internal or Lead Auditor certification for ISO standards
  • First Aid and Fire Safety training
  • Working knowledge of CDM regulations
